The Los Angeles Kings are heading home with an impressive win over the Carolina Hurricanes. They are able to end a road trip that has been pretty tough on a high note after losing the first four games of the trip.

It certainly took a team effort to secure the 4-2 win over the Hurricanes but these were three players in particular who really stood out for the Los Angeles Kings.

Kevin Fiala

The Los Angeles Kings really struggled to score goals on this road trip, after getting shutout in the last two games entering Saturday. They were able to change that against the Hurricanes with four goals, including two from Kevin Fiala.

Fiala would score one goal in the second period that extended the Kings lead to 3-1 and after the Hurricanes scored in third period, Fiala added his second goal of the night to once again give them a two goal lead.

One of the reasons for the Kings struggles offensively is that they don't have a true second option in terms of a goal scorer. Kevin Fiala certainly can be that but he has been very inconsistent and it shows how different this offense is when he is producing.
